The formation and development of ordinary differential equations are closely related to the development of mechanics,physics and other subjects. In recent years, with the continuously progress of science and technology, many achievements need the related theory of nonlinear analysis and differential equations with boundary value problem as the theoretical support. And the researchers pay more and more attention to the nonlinear problems. Therefore, the study of boundary value problems of nonlinear differential equation has very important significance and practical value. The existence and multiplicity of solutions is investigated in the paper for the two kinds of fourth-order three-point boundary value problems.In the paper, there are four chapters,and the content is as follows:In chapter 1, the first part mainly introduces the symbols, definitions and theorems referenced in the paper; The second part summarizes the development, research significance and status of the nonlinear fourth-order boundary value problems; The last part introduces the arrangements of the main contents of the paper.In chapter 2, the existence and multiplicity of positive solutions is investigated by using the Avery-Peterson fixed-point theory for the following fourth-order three-point boundary value problem or We obtain some sufficient conditions of the existence of triple positive solutions of the boundary value problem.In chapter 3, the existence of solutions and positive solutions for the fourth-order three-point integral boundary value problem is studied.We use the Leray-Schauder fixed-point theorem, and obtain a sufficient condition of the existence of solutions for the three-point integral boundary value problem under the derivative of unknown function in the nonlinear term. By constructing a function we also obtain a sufficient condition for the existence of positive solutions of the problem.In chapter 4, the full paper is summarized, and we will put forward the direction of the following research.
